Our Nigeria News Magazine
The news is by your side.

Heckling Urchins in Diaspora

Heckling Urchins in Diaspora  By Dr Hassan Gimba For some time now, social media has been inundated with video clips of some Nigerians displaying to the world the attitudes of the urchins…